Position: Director of Enrollment Management, 2 Hour Learning - $200,000/year USD

While most enrollment positions prioritize volume, this role is designed to safeguard standards. Alpha is constructing one of the world's most forward-thinking school models. Our campuses integrate demanding academics, technology-enhanced learning, and elevated expectations for both students and faculty. Students routinely exceed national learning benchmarks, supported by verifiable data. Afternoons are dedicated to depth, autonomy, and practical skill development. The model delivers results.

But success depends entirely on enrolling the right families. That is your mandate. You will control the complete admissions process for a campus, spanning initial application to final enrollment. This is not a role where responsibilities are passed between departments. You are accountable for the family experience, the clarity with which they grasp our model, and ensuring enrollment decisions are made with proper alignment.

You will evaluate compatibility, facilitate meaningful dialogue, and advocate for declining applicants when appropriate. Maximum enrollment is not the objective. Alignment is.

We welcome candidates from high-end service backgrounds outside conventional education: selective private schools, competitive programs, premium hospitality, executive assistance, elite membership organizations, or entrepreneurs who have directly overseen high‑stakes client relationships from beginning to end. What counts is your capacity to execute a refined, multi‑phase process with discernment, precision, and accountability. If your career has centered on delivering exceptional service where trust, confidentiality, and experience quality define reputation, this position will resonate.

What You Will Be Doing
  • Taking complete ownership of the enrollment experience for prospective families, spanning initial outreach to final onboarding.
  • Facilitating diagnostic conversations to evaluate compatibility before offering solutions or suggesting subsequent actions.
  • Overseeing 20+ concurrent family engagements across various enrollment stages, maintaining transparent tracking and timely follow‑up.
  • Directing campus visits, student shadow days, and commitment discussions that articulate outcomes, expectations, and ideal candidate profiles.
  • Ensuring precise CRM and enrollment documentation (Hub Spot and SIS) to enable forecasting, prioritization, and service excellence.
What You Won’t Be Doing
  • Employing transactional or aggressive sales methods.
  • Accepting misaligned families to satisfy enrollment targets.
  • Overseeing a substantial team or navigating complex approval hierarchies.
  • Fragmenting family relationship ownership across multiple personnel.
  • Operating remotely. This position requires on‑campus presence.
Director Of Enrollment Management

Key Responsibilities

Design and deliver a high‑trust, selective enrollment process that successfully converts compatible families while preserving the integrity and academic performance of the Alpha model.

Basic Requirements
  • 3+ years providing premium, individualized service in settings where service excellence directly influences brand credibility (education, luxury hospitality, executive assistance, exclusive membership organizations, or independently operated service businesses).
  • Proven ownership of a complete client, admissions, or enrollment pathway from initial engagement through final onboarding.
  • Experience concurrently managing 20+ client, guest, or family accounts at varying stages, utilizing a clear tracking and prioritization methodology.
  • Capacity to supply specific examples of advisory decision‑making, including instances where you recommended against your offering when alignment was absent.
  • Professional written correspondence experience with C‑suite executives, high‑net‑worth clients, or discerning audiences.
  • Willingness to reside in or relocate within 60 days to one of these markets:
    Greenwich, CT;
    Boca Raton, FL;
    Atlanta, GA; or Boston, MA.
  • Authorized to work in the United States without visa sponsorship.
Nice‑to‑have Requirements
  • Experience in competitive private school admissions or selective program recruitment.
  • Background in premium hospitality, VIP client services, or C‑level support functions.
  • Experience developing or enhancing enrollment workflows, standard operating procedures, or service benchmarks.
  • Proficiency leveraging data and CRM analytics to optimize conversion quality, not merely velocity.
Working with Us

This is a full‑time (40 hours per week) long‑term position. The position is immediately available and requires entering into an independent contractor agreement with Crossover as a Contractor of Record. The compensation level for this role is $100 USD/hour, which equates to $200,000 USD/year assuming 40 hours per week and 50 weeks per year. The payment period is weekly.
